Chimney Inspection Service in San Francisco, CA

Chimney inspection services involve a thorough assessment of the interior and exterior of a chimney to ensure it is safe, functional, and free from potential hazards. These inspections typically cover checking for creosote buildup, structural damage, blockages, and signs of deterioration that could affect proper venting or increase fire risk. Homeowners often request inspections before the start of the heating season, after a chimney has experienced unusual odors or smoke issues, or following severe weather events that might have impacted the chimney’s integrity.

Property owners usually want to understand the current condition of their chimney, identify any issues that may require repairs, and ensure that the chimney complies with safety standards. It’s common to inquire about the scope of the inspection, what potential problems might be found, and whether additional services such as cleaning or repairs are recommended. Clear communication about the inspection process helps homeowners make informed decisions about maintaining their chimney’s safety and efficiency.

FAQ

Chimney Inspection Service Questions

What is included in a chimney inspection? A thorough inspection assesses the chimney’s structure, flue lining, and venting system to identify potential issues or blockages.

How often should a chimney be inspected? Regular inspections are recommended at least once a year to ensure safe and efficient operation.

What signs indicate a chimney needs inspection? Signs include smoke backdrafts, soot buildup, unusual odors, or visible damage to the chimney structure.

What are the benefits of a professional chimney inspection? It helps prevent fire hazards, improves appliance efficiency, and can detect issues before they become costly repairs.
